Schultz v. Van Doren

55 A. 1133, 65 N.J. Eq. 764, 1903 N.J. LEXIS 304
Supreme Court of New Jersey·Decided August 25, 1903·Published

Opinion

Per Curiam.

The decree appealed from in this case is affirmed, for the reasons set forth in the opinion of Vice-Chancellor Pitney, filed in the court of chancery, and reported in 19 Dick. Ch. Rep. 465.

For affirmance — The Chief-Justice, Van Syokel, Dixon, Garrison, Port, Hendrickson, Pitney, Swayze, Bogert, Vredenburgi-i, Voori-iees, Vroom, Green- — 13.

For reversal — None.
